hsqldb中建一个数据库
时间: 2024-05-06 09:18:16 浏览: 16
首先,你需要下载并安装 HSQLDB。安装完成后,在控制台或命令行中启动 HSQLDB Server:
```
java -cp path/to/hsqldb.jar org.hsqldb.server.Server
```
接下来,在控制台或命令行中连接到 HSQLDB Server:
```
java -cp path/to/hsqldb.jar org.hsqldb.util.DatabaseManagerSwing
```
在 Database Manager 中,选择 "New" 创建一个新的数据库。在弹出的对话框中,输入数据库名称、用户名和密码,并选择 "HSQLDB Server" 作为数据库类型。然后点击 "OK" 创建数据库。
现在你已经成功创建了一个 HSQLDB 数据库。你可以通过 Database Manager 或 JDBC 连接到该数据库,并创建表和插入数据等操作。
相关问题
hsqldb怎么监控数据库连接池?
HSQLDB 提供了一个名为「SQL Tool」的监控工具,可以通过该工具来监控数据库连接池。以下是使用 SQL Tool 监控 HSQLDB 数据库连接池的步骤:
1. 启动 HSQLDB 服务器
使用命令行启动 HSQLDB 服务器,例如:
```
java -cp hsqldb.jar org.hsqldb.server.Server --database.0 file:mydb --dbname.0 mydb
```
其中,`hsqldb.jar` 是 HSQLDB 的 jar 包路径,`mydb` 是数据库名称,`--database.0` 和 `--dbname.0` 参数用于指定数据库文件和名称。
2. 连接到 HSQLDB 服务器
打开命令行,使用以下命令连接到 HSQLDB 服务器:
```
java -cp hsqldb.jar org.hsqldb.util.SqlTool
```
连接成功后,会出现 SQL Tool 的提示符 `sql>`。
3. 查看连接池状态
执行以下语句,查看当前连接池的状态:
```
sql> !hsqldb:gc
```
该命令会显示当前连接池的状态,包括连接数、空闲连接数等信息。
除了使用 SQL Tool,还可以通过 HSQLDB 的系统表来监控连接池。例如,执行以下语句可以查看当前连接数:
```
SELECT COUNT(*) FROM INFORMATION_SCHEMA.SYSTEM_SESSIONS;
```
执行以下语句可以查看当前空闲连接数:
```
SELECT COUNT(*) FROM INFORMATION_SCHEMA.SYSTEM_SESSIONS WHERE USERNAME='SA' AND STATE='IDLE';
```
以上是使用 SQL Tool 和系统表来监控 HSQLDB 数据库连接池的方法。
hsqldb.jar下载使用
hsqldb.jar是一个用于Java开发的数据库驱动程序,可以用于在Java应用程序中访问和操作HSQLDB数据库。要使用hsqldb.jar,首先需要下载该驱动程序并将其添加到Java项目的类路径中。
1. 在网上搜索hsqldb.jar的下载链接,可以在HSQLDB官方网站或者Maven中央仓库等地方找到该驱动程序的下载链接。
2. 确保你拥有一个HSQLDB数据库实例,如果没有,需要先安装和配置HSQLDB数据库。
3. 下载hsqldb.jar文件,并保存到你的项目文件夹下的lib文件夹中。
4. 在你的Java项目中,打开项目配置文件(例如pom.xml)并添加hsqldb.jar到项目的依赖中。
5. 在你的Java代码中,使用Java的数据库连接API(如JDBC)来连接和操作HSQLDB数据库。
6. 在连接数据库时,需要提供HSQLDB数据库的连接信息,包括数据库URL、用户名和密码等。
7. 通过hsqldb.jar提供的API来执行SQL查询、插入、更新和删除操作,从而对HSQLDB数据库进行操作。
8. 在使用完hsqldb.jar后,记得关闭数据库连接,释放相关资源,以避免资源泄露和不必要的性能消耗。
总之,使用hsqldb.jar需要先下载并导入到Java项目中,然后通过Java的数据库连接API来连接和操作HSQLDB数据库。在使用时,需要注意安全性和资源管理的问题,以确保程序的稳定和性能。